There is a possibility to create a Windows 7 installation DVD that runs fully automated without any user interaction - this is done by placing a file called autounattend.xml into the image's root directory. In this file you specify all the keywords that will be read into the fields of the installation process. Home Blog Unattended deployment of Windows 7 via WDS. Unattend.txt File Format In general, an answer file consists of section headers, parameters, and values for those parameters. Most of the section headers are predefined (although some may be user-defined). It is not necessary to specify all the possible parameters and keys in the Unattend.txt file if the installation does not require them. The unattend answer file contains an invalid product key. Either remove the invalid key or provide a valid product key in the unattend answer file to proceed with Windows installation. Cause. This issue occurs because the installation media contains an unattended setup file with an embedded product key. Resolution
